[[File:KDL Hurly sprite.png]] '''Hurly''' is an enemy from ''[[Kirby's Dream Land]]'', found only in the [[Castle Lololo]] stage. It is found only in [[Extra Game]] - replacing [[Chuckie]] - and behaves in much the same way, though dealing two points of damage instead of just one. Hurly can be distinguished from Chuckie by its darker body color and "smile" on its face.

Hurly pops out of boxes with question marks in the halls of the castle, falling out and off the screen, hurting Kirby if he makes contact. These boxes will continuously pop out Hurlys, and never run out, no matter how many Kirby eats.

In ''[[Kirby's Pinball Land]]'', Hurly appears in the [[Kracko Land]] stage, transforming from [[Chuckie|Chucky]] whenever [[Mr. Shine & Mr. Bright|Mr. Shine]] comes out. It bounces about in a higher arc than Chucky, and is worth 2000 points when hit. When hit three times, it transforms into a [[Maxim Tomato]].
